Output 24b559433ba6c2300d33d6110e958bb0fc7c8d787a1a3140d624994dfefd16c0:0

value
7658000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31017e177f4656c509ae9a2262180c7b76e5f6ab OP_EQUAL
address
MCNH8XuwYFZ7125wCsBGSsTHLExMwcSui5
transaction
24b559433ba6c2300d33d6110e958bb0fc7c8d787a1a3140d624994dfefd16c0
spent
true